Summary

Ray Wiltsey Middle is a public school serving about 730 students in grades 6 through 8 within the Ontario-Montclair School District, serving a community with high economic need where over 95% of students qualify for free or reduced-price lunch.

Academically, the school's proficiency rates in English, Math, and Science are below both state and Ontario-Montclair district averages, and it is one of the lower-performing middle schools in its own district, notably lagging behind peers like Oaks Middle and De Anza Middle. However, Ray Wiltsey has shown positive momentum, improving its statewide ranking over the last decade and significantly reducing chronic student absenteeism to a rate that is now better than the California average.

The school has some notable strengths, including a better student-teacher ratio than many nearby schools, which can mean smaller class sizes, and it shows particularly strong results for specific student groups, such as homeless students. An interesting point for parents is that the school receives higher per-student funding than several higher-performing area schools like Grace Yokley Junior High and Ruth Musser Middle, yet its overall academic outcomes are lower, suggesting a focus on how resources are used. Families may want to inquire about targeted supports, especially in 8th-grade math where scores dip noticeably.
